Given that some people say that the first sector to rebound in a cyclical recovery should be test and assembly, rather than front end, does anybody think that the following report is significant?

NEW YORK, Dec 9 (Reuters) - Credit Suisse First Boston
analyst Elliot Rogers said Wednesday he raised Teradyne Inc.'s
(NYSE:TER) fiscal year 1999 estimate and target price.
-- Rogers' $0.10 increase in 1999's EPS projection, to
$1.25, and the higher target price to $60 from $40 reflect
building order momentum in the fourth quarter together with
solid prospective gains in cost containment.
-- Both semiconductor test and non-semiconductor-related
orders are ahead of plan in the fourth quarter, with orders now
forecast around $300 million versus the prior estimate of $270
million.
